Having found no sugar for my coffee in the office, and being annoyed at this extreme shortage of a required commodity, I went to the local supermarket (the GIANT) to replenish the supply.

Upon entering the store I grabbed a red hand basket and proceeded to the spices aisle where I procured a 5 pound bag of sugar on isle 6 and dropped it in. I next realized, being the gourmet that I am, that I would rather have some flavored non-dairy creamer. So I wandered over to aisle 1 and got a few cartons of my favorite low fat hazelnut blend.

Since I also wanted to get some bottled water. I went over to the other end of the store, around aisle 20 to find some. The clerk in that aisle thought the water was over in aisle 16 so I went over there. No luck.

Now, while this was happening, you know how you hear announcements in supermarkets when people drop things? "clean up on aisle X" and the like? Well this was happening but I just was only dimly aware of it. The first I remember hearing was, "clean-up on aisle 6." Well, I didn't drop anything so I did not even think about it.

The next announcement, somewhat more frantic was "two staff to aisles 2 through 12, bring dust mops and brooms!" Again, I didn't do anything so this was just background noise to me.

In the meantime, since the water was NOT in aisle 16, I found out it was in aisle 17 so I went over there and got my favorite bottled spring water. That task having been completed, I proceeded down aisle 17 to the front of the store, and across the front of the entire huge store to checkout counter number 1 which was for the "10 items or less" shopper, which I surely was one.

Now the announcements of the store manager are even more frantic, "Six stock room staff with mops and brooms to aisles 12-20 back of the store, all remaining personnel proceed to the front of the store for additional clean up."

"Hmmmm, I says to myself, must be quite a mess!"

As I am standing in line, my shoes are starting to feel a bit "grainy" and the customer behind me says "Do you know, sir, that your bag of sugar is leaking?"
